Jun 13, 2023 · There are several ways to invest in government bonds in India, including: #1. RBI Retail Direct. RBI Retail Direct is an online platform launched by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) in 2020, which allows you to invest in government securities directly. Nov 21, 2023 · The government bond India interest rate remains constant until the bond matures, irrespective of fluctuating market conditions. Fixed-rate bonds can be issued for one year to thirty years or more. The longer the tenure, the higher the interest rate offered to compensate for the longer lock-in period.

Explore Central Government Securities and G-Sec for Secure Investment in Government Securities.WebIn return, government bonds provide a coupon rate which is calculated on the face value amount and generally all bonds have a face value amount of Rs. 100. Suppose a government bond’s name is 6.76% GS 2061 then here the coupon rate will be calculated on face value amount which will come at Rs. 6.76 for each unit.5 months ago 4 min Investing in bonds is becoming a popular option for portfolio diversification. The 7.75% Government of India Savings Bond is a fixed-rate bond issued by the government of India. These bonds have a maturity period of 7 years and offer a fixed interest rate of 7.75% per annum payable semi-annually. They are available to resident individuals, HUFs, and trusts. Bonds are debt instruments in which an investor lends money to any entity. The entity borrows money at a fixed interest rate for a set period of time. This entity could be the government, a bank, or a corporation. As a result, when the government issues bonds, they are referred to as government bonds.Web
